Focke-Wulf Fw 190 D-9 Dora V1.0
For SimplePlanes

The Fw 190 Dora is easily distinguished from its predecessors by the Jumo 213A inline engine as opposed to the radial BMW 801, which required lengthening the nose to fit the engine and the tail to balance the airframe. Compared to earlier Fw 190’s, the Dora boasts a superior turn rate, climb rate, and dive speed. In the latter stages of the Second World War when it was introduced, the Fw 190 D-9 would mainly serve in the anti-fighter role and some squadrons would cover Me 262 airfields, as they were vulnerable on takeoff and landing.

Nazi Germany was the military sole operator of the Fw 190 D-9, excluding captured airframes. There are still several surviving examples of Fw 190’s in museums, with three being D-9’s. While no Fw 190 D-9’s are airworthy today, there is one airworthy D-13 at the Flying Heritage Collection in Everett, Washington. However, it is grounded since it is the last remaining airworthy D-13.
